jQuery是一个快速、简洁的JavaScript库,它简化了HTML文档遍历、事件处理、动画设计和Ajax交互等操作,在jQuery中,我们可以使用多种方法来请求数据,其中最常用的方法是使用 $.ajax()函数,下面我将详细介绍如何使用jQuery请求数据。,1、引入jQuery库,在使用jQuery之前,我们需要在HTML文件中引入jQuery库,可以通过以下两种方式之一引入:,方式一:使用 <script>标签引入,方式二:通过 CDN引入,2、编写HTML结构,在引入jQuery库之后,我们需要编写一个简单的HTML结构,用于展示请求到的数据,我们可以创建一个包含列表项的无序列表:,3、编写JavaScript代码(main.js),接下来,我们在 main.js文件中编写JavaScript代码,使用jQuery的 $.ajax()函数请求数据,并将数据显示在HTML页面上,以下是一个简单的示例:,在这个示例中,我们首先定义了一个变量 url,用于存储请求数据的URL,我们使用 $.ajax()函数发起一个GET请求,指定请求类型为”GET”,预期服务器返回的数据类型为”json”,在请求成功的回调函数中,我们遍历返回的数据,并为每个数据项创建一个新的列表项,将其添加到页面上的列表中,如果请求失败,我们将在控制台中显示错误信息。,4、运行示例,将上述HTML和JavaScript代码保存到同一个文件夹中,并在浏览器中打开HTML文件,此时,你应该可以看到页面上显示了一个无序列表,列表中的每一项都包含了从API获取的数据,如果一切正常,说明我们已经成功地使用jQuery请求了数据。,
获取value html的方法主要有两种,一种是通过浏览器的开发者工具,另一种是通过服务器端的语言,下面我将详细介绍这两种方法。,1、打开你想要获取value html的网页。,2、右键点击页面,选择“检查”或者“审查元素”,这将打开浏览器的开发者工具。,3、在开发者工具中,你可以看到页面的HTML代码,这些代码就是value html。,4、你可以通过点击开发者工具中的“Elements”选项卡,然后选择你想要查看的元素,来获取该元素的value html。,5、你也可以直接在开发者工具的控制台中输入JavaScript代码来获取value html,你可以输入 document.getElementById('yourElementId').innerHTML;来获取id为’yourElementId’的元素的value html。,如果你想要通过服务器端的语言来获取value html,你需要使用到服务器端的语言的HTTP库和HTML解析库,以下是一个使用Python和BeautifulSoup库的示例:,1、你需要安装BeautifulSoup库,你可以使用pip来安装: pip install beautifulsoup4。,2、你需要使用服务器端的语言来发送一个HTTP请求到你想要获取value html的网页,你可以使用Python的requests库来发送一个GET请求:,3、接下来,你需要解析HTTP响应中的HTML内容,你可以使用BeautifulSoup库来解析HTML:,4、现在,你可以使用BeautifulSoup库的方法来获取value html,你可以使用 .prettify()方法来获取整个页面的value html:,5、你也可以使用BeautifulSoup库的方法来获取特定元素的value html,你可以使用 find()或 find_all()方法来获取特定元素的HTML:,以上就是如何获得value html的方法,需要注意的是,获取value html可能会受到网页的robots.txt文件和CORS策略的限制,如果你遇到任何问题,你可能需要联系网页的所有者或者管理员。, ,import requests from bs4 import BeautifulSoup url = ‘http://example.com’ response = requests.get(url),soup = BeautifulSoup(response.text, ‘html.parser’),print(soup.prettify()),element = soup.find(‘div’, {‘class’: ‘myclass’}) print(element),
在Web开发中,Session是一种在多个页面之间保持状态的方法,它允许服务器在多个请求之间存储用户的数据,例如用户的登录状态、购物车内容等,HTML无法直接获取Session,但可以通过JavaScript与后端服务器进行交互来实现这一目的。,在本教程中,我们将介绍如何使用JavaScript(具体来说是使用jQuery库)从后端服务器获取Session数据,我们将使用PHP作为后端语言,因为它是最常见的服务器端脚本语言之一。,1、我们需要在 HTML文件中引入jQuery库,将以下代码添加到 <head>标签内:,2、接下来,我们需要创建一个用于显示Session数据的HTML元素,在 <body>标签内添加一个 <div>元素,并为其分配一个ID,例如 sessionData:,3、现在,我们可以编写JavaScript代码来获取Session数据并将其显示在HTML元素中,在 <script>标签内添加以下代码:,这段代码首先使用jQuery的 $.ajax()方法向后端服务器发送一个GET请求,请求的URL应指向一个处理Session数据的PHP文件(在这个例子中,我们将其命名为 get_session_data.php),请确保将此URL替换为你自己的后端文件路径。,success回调函数将在请求成功时执行,它将从服务器接收到的JSON格式的Session数据转换为字符串,并将其显示在名为 sessionData的HTML元素中,如果请求失败,将显示一条错误消息。,4、我们需要创建一个PHP文件来处理Session数据,创建一个名为 get_session_data.php的文件,并在其中添加以下代码:,这段代码首先检查是否已设置Session,如果已设置,它将获取Session数据,将其转换为JSON格式,并将其输出,如果未设置Session,它将返回一个空数组。,现在,当你在浏览器中打开包含上述HTML和JavaScript代码的网页时,你应该能看到从后端服务器获取的Session数据,请注意,这个示例仅用于演示目的,实际应用中可能需要根据具体需求对代码进行调整。, ,<script src=”https://code.jquery.com/jquery3.6.0.min.js”></script>,<div id=”sessionData”></div>,$(document).ready(function() { $.ajax({ url: ‘get_session_data.php’, // 修改为你的后端文件路径 type: ‘GET’, dataType: ‘json’, success: function(data) { $(‘#sessionData’).html(‘Session数据:’ + JSON.stringify(data)); }, error: function() { $(‘#sessionData’).html(‘获取Session数据失败’); } }); });,<?php // 检查是否已设置Session if (isset($_SESSION)) { // 获取Session数据 $sessionData = $_SESSION; // 将Session数据转换为JSON格式并输出 echo json_encode($sessionData); } else { // 如果未设置Session,返回空数组 echo json_encode([]); } ?>,
在获取哔哩哔哩页面的HTML文件夹时,我们通常会使用爬虫技术,爬虫是一种自动化获取网页内容的程序,它可以模拟人类浏览网页的行为,自动抓取网页上的信息,在Python中,我们可以使用requests库来发送HTTP请求,使用BeautifulSoup库来解析HTML文档,从而获取我们需要的信息。,以下是获取 哔哩哔哩页面HTML文件夹的详细步骤:,1、安装所需库:我们需要安装requests和BeautifulSoup库,这两个库可以通过pip命令进行安装,在命令行中输入以下命令:,2、导入库:在Python代码中,我们需要导入requests和BeautifulSoup库,代码如下:,3、发送HTTP请求:接下来,我们需要发送一个HTTP请求到目标网站,获取其HTML文档,在Python中,我们可以使用requests库的get方法来发送请求,代码如下:,4、解析HTML文档:获取到HTML文档后,我们需要使用BeautifulSoup库来解析它,代码如下:,5、提取信息:现在,我们已经获取到了HTML文档,并解析了它,接下来,我们就可以提取我们需要的信息了,如果我们想要提取所有的视频标题,我们可以遍历所有的视频标签,然后提取它们的标题属性,代码如下:,6、保存信息:我们可以将提取到的信息保存到文件中,我们可以将视频标题保存到一个txt文件中,代码如下:,以上就是获取哔哩哔哩页面HTML文件夹的详细步骤,需要注意的是,由于网站的结构可能会发生变化,因此上述代码可能需要根据实际情况进行调整,爬虫可能会对网站服务器造成压力,因此在爬取网站时,应遵守网站的robots.txt规则,不要对网站造成过大的影响。, ,pip install requests beautifulsoup4,import requests from bs4 import BeautifulSoup,url = ‘https://www.bilibili.com/’ # 这里替换为你需要爬取的哔哩哔哩页面URL response = requests.get(url) html_doc = response.text,soup = BeautifulSoup(html_doc, ‘html.parser’),video_titles = for video in soup.find_all(‘div’, class_=’info’)]
获取网页的HTML文件,通常可以通过两种方式:一种是手动复制粘贴,另一种是通过编程方式,这里我们主要介绍通过编程方式来获取网页的HTML文件。,在Python中,我们可以使用requests库和BeautifulSoup库来实现这个功能,requests库用于发送HTTP请求,获取网页的HTML内容;BeautifulSoup库用于解析HTML内容,提取我们需要的信息。,以下是具体的步骤:,1、安装requests和BeautifulSoup库,在命令行中输入以下命令:,2、导入requests和BeautifulSoup库,在Python代码中输入以下命令:,3、发送HTTP请求,获取网页的HTML内容,在Python代码中输入以下命令:,4、解析HTML内容,提取我们需要的信息,在Python代码中输入以下命令:,以上就是通过编程方式获取网页HTML文件的基本步骤,需要注意的是,不同的网页可能有不同的结构,因此在实际使用时,可能需要根据具体的网页结构来修改代码。,如果网页使用了动态加载技术(例如Ajax),那么直接发送HTTP请求可能无法获取到完整的HTML内容,在这种情况下,我们可能需要使用更复杂的工具,例如Selenium或Scrapy等。,Selenium是一个自动化测试工具,可以模拟用户操作浏览器,从而获取动态加载的内容,Scrapy是一个强大的爬虫框架,可以处理各种复杂的网页结构和反爬机制,这两个工具的使用都比较复杂,需要一定的编程基础和网络知识,如果你对这些工具感兴趣,可以查阅相关的教程和文档,深入学习和实践。,获取网页的HTML文件是一项非常实用的技能,可以帮助我们快速获取和分析网络信息,通过学习和实践,我们可以掌握这项技能,提高我们的工作效率和学习效果。,,pip install requests beautifulsoup4,import requests from bs4 import BeautifulSoup,url = ‘https://www.bilibili.com’ # 这里替换为你想要获取HTML内容的网页URL response = requests.get(url) html_content = response.text # 获取网页的HTML内容,soup = BeautifulSoup(html_content, ‘html.parser’) # 使用BeautifulSoup解析HTML内容 这里可以添加你需要提取的信息,例如提取所有的标题 titles = soup.find_all(‘h1’) # 查找所有的h1标签,即所有的标题 for title in titles: print(title.text) # 打印每个标题的文本内容,